23 Chinese coal miners killed in two blasts

Explosions tore through two Chinese coal mines hundred of miles apart, killing 23 workers, the government said today.

A blast in Rong Sheng Coal Mine in Jiudonggou, a village in Inner Mongolia, occurred at 4am (8pm Irish time Sunday) and trapped the 33 miners working in the pit, the official Xinhua News Agency said.
